How much do program development man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 26, 2026, the average yearly pay for program development manager in Mineola, NY is $126,988.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$85,700.00 and $151,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a program development manager?

To thrive as a Program Development Manager, you need strong project management abilities, strategic planning skills, and a background in program design, often supported by a bachelor’s or master’s degree in business, nonprofit management, or a related field. Familiarity with project management software such as Asana or MS Project, and certifications like PMP, are commonly required for effective oversight. Excellent leadership, communication, and stakeholder engagement skills help drive collaboration and motivate teams. These competencies are crucial for delivering successful programs that meet organizational goals and stakeholder expectations.

What are some common challenges faced by program development managers, and how can they address them?

Program Development Managers often encounter challenges such as aligning cross-functional teams, managing competing priorities, and ensuring that program goals meet both organizational and stakeholder needs. To address these challenges, effective communication, strong project management skills, and adaptability are essential. Regular check-ins with team members and stakeholders, clear goal-setting, and the use of project management tools can help streamline processes and keep programs on track. Building strong relationships across departments also facilitates smoother collaboration and problem-solving.

What is the difference between Program Development Manager vs Project Manager?

AspectProgram Development ManagerProject Manager
Primary FocusOversees multiple related projects to achieve strategic goalsManages individual projects to meet specific objectives
ResponsibilitiesDevelops program strategies, coordinates projects, manages stakeholdersPlans, executes, and closes projects within scope, time, and budget
CredentialsOften requires a PMP or similar certification, relevant experienceTypically requires PMP or CAPM certification, project management experience
Work EnvironmentStrategic planning, cross-project coordination, stakeholder communicationProject planning, team management, task execution

The Program Development Manager focuses on overseeing multiple projects aligned with strategic goals, while the Project Manager manages individual projects. Both roles require project management certifications and involve coordinating teams, but the Program Development Manager has a broader, strategic scope.

Job description

Position Summary

The Director of Program Development is responsible for expanding and enhancing Commonpoint's tennis programming across multiple facilities. This role focuses on creating, implementing, and evaluating new programs that increase participation, improve the customer experience, and generate sustainable revenue. Working closely with the Senior Director of Operations, Director of Tennis, and site leadership, this position will lead program development efforts at satellite locations—including Bay Terrace and Tannenbaum Family Pool—while also identifying new opportunities to strengthen programming at Alley Pond Tennis Center and future Commonpoint facilities. This role is ideal for an innovative leader who enjoys building programs from the ground up, identifying community needs, and turning ideas into successful offerings.

Essential ResponsibilitiesProgram Development
  • Design and launch new tennis and recreation programs at Bay Terrace, Tannenbaum Family Pool, and future Commonpoint locations.
  • Evaluate current programming and recommend enhancements to improve participation, retention, and financial performance.
  • Develop seasonal program offerings for juniors, adults, camps, clinics, leagues, and special events.
  • Create standardized program models that can be replicated across multiple facilities.
Business Growth
  • Identify opportunities to expand programming into new communities, facilities, and partnerships.
  • Research market trends and customer demand to recommend new initiatives.
  • Assist in the planning and implementation of new facility launches and program expansions.
  • Explore new revenue-generating opportunities while supporting Commonpoint's mission.
Alley Pond Program Support
  • Collaborate with the Alley Pond leadership team to develop new programs and improve existing offerings.
  • Assist in launching pilot programs and evaluating their success.
  • Recommend scheduling improvements and programming innovations based on participation data.
Collaboration & Operations
  • Work closely with Directors, Tennis Professionals, and Operations staff to ensure successful implementation of new programs.
  • Develop program guidelines, schedules, marketing information, and operational procedures.
  • Assist with staff training and onboarding related to new programs.
  • Support cross-site consistency in program quality and customer experience.
  • Oversee and execute the registration process of new programs.
Performance & Evaluation
  • Track enrollment, revenue, retention, and customer feedback for new initiatives.
  • Provide regular reports and recommendations to leadership.
  • Make data-driven adjustments to maximize program success.
Qualifications
  • Tennis teaching and program management experience preferred.
  • Experience developing recreational, educational, or sports programming.
  • Strong organizational and project management skills.
  • Ability to work independently while collaborating across multiple teams.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Creative thinker with strong problem-solving abilities.
  • Comfortable using Microsoft Office and Google Workspace.
Preferred Skills
  • Experience launching new programs or business initiatives.
  • Knowledge of youth and adult tennis programming.
  • Marketing and community outreach experience.
  • Budget awareness and understanding of program profitability.
  • Passion for growing participation through innovative programming.
Success Measures
  • Successful launch of new programs across Commonpoint facilities.
  • Growth in program participation and enrollment.
  • Increased program revenue and sustainability.
  • High participant satisfaction and retention.
  • Development of scalable program models that can be replicated at future locations.
  • Identification and implementation of new opportunities for organizational growth.
